### Step 4: Sign and push the dedupe batch

Before merging, confirm the reviewer checklist for Collatrix's customer-record deduplication job is complete: merge rules validated against the staging snapshot, survivorship policy set to most-recent-write, and the dry-run report attached to the change. Once approved, the release pipeline signs the dedupe artifact and pushes it to the Harbrook registry. Verification will fail unless the artifact is signed with the current deploy key, shown here.

rollout seal: bky4_x7Gc

To: Dispatch Desk
Subject: Sealed-bid tender — Corbally Municipal Works

Our sealed bid for the Renwyck bridge tender must reach the Corbally clerk's office before noon Friday. Envelope is wax-sealed; do not open or photograph it. One courier only, direct route, no interim stops. The confidential hand-over instruction for the courier appears below.

courier memo of fahag-badug: the norys istion courier leaves the zoriel ledger at gate 4000 under passcode 457370

Welcome to on-call for the Glimmerpane design system! Our snapshot tests live in the `snapcheck` suite and run on every merge to main. If a UI component changes visually, the diff bot flags it — usually it's an intentional tweak, so just approve the new baseline. If it's 2am and snapshots are failing across the board, it's almost always a font-loading race, not your problem. To unlock the baseline store and re-approve snapshots in bulk, use the recovery passphrase below.

recovery phrase for tahag-taguf: wenix-caswyn

// Ticket-pricing experiment client (project Farewell Fox).
// This talks to the internal Pricepin service to fetch variant
// assignments for the dynamic-pricing A/B test. Heads up for
// review: traffic is staging-only, variants carry no payment
// data, and assignments expire after 24h. Nothing here touches
// the checkout path directly. Pricepin auth uses the key below.

app token of bawep-hafog = kto7_vwrmnlx